Transaction 33200938768b146fcae52f797d159f12f00d0cc8110402c425e23cfd0d617f21

1 Input
2 Outputs
  • 33200938768b146fcae52f797d159f12f00d0cc8110402c425e23cfd0d617f21:0
  • value  28445574
    address  2NESRUGmK6S9dpt1NhqvfVu665pbRu4u8mK
  • 33200938768b146fcae52f797d159f12f00d0cc8110402c425e23cfd0d617f21:1
  • value  20000
    address  mvbKbN3EtT8zX9Dk2wUQ7cAPoWnMKeyUTb